dc.description.abstractThe most widely used method for producing biodiesel is the transesterification reaction, in which oil and excess alcohol are mixed with a catalyst. However, because the reactants are partially miscible it is necessary to maintain the reaction under mechanical agitation and heating for a certain time. Therefore, this is a method that consumes a lot of energy and for this, some alternatives are being increasingly researched, such as the use of ultrasound, which promotes cavitations in the reaction medium, and also the use of co-solvent, both increase the contact between the phases. In this way this work aims to produce biodiesel by transesterification using ultrassonic bath. To obtain the samples were used etanol and soybean oil, in the molar ratio of 10,2:1, with potassium hydroxide catalyst. In the experiments were varied the temperatures, reaction times and the use of biodiesel as co-solvent. After the analysis of density and conversion of the reactions, it was possible to notice that the application of ultrassonic bath is a promising technology to promote decrease in the reaction time and consequently, to reduce energy expenditure.
